Magneti Marelli, a leading supplier of mobility technologies to the automotive industry, will showcase its most innovative products at the 2024 CES at the Wynn Las Vegas from January 9 to 11, 2024. Through a carefully curated experience, Magneti Marelli will demonstrate its approach to innovation through design.

Guests invited to the exhibition will participate in a customized journey to gain an in-depth understanding of the various stages of vehicle co-creation. As a first step, guests will enter the Digital Twin Studio and answer some questions about their driving preferences to generate data that matches their driving personalization. Functions generated based on this data will be displayed in the demo car later in the journey. Guests will also learn about Magneti Marelli's digital twin technology.

In the "Co-creation@Speed" area, guests will gain a deeper understanding of Magneti Marelli's value proposition through software-defined cars and interact with technologies powered by Amazon Web Services (AWS), QNX and Qualcomm. They will learn about Magneti Marelli's technologies supporting architecture scalability, software portability, domain control standardization and cloud virtualization. Guests will also be able to interact with Magneti Marelli's digital twin demonstrator, which can simulate the vehicle cockpit in the cloud.

After touring the Digital Twin Studio and the Co-creation@Speed ​​area, guests were able to get behind the wheel of one of the demo cars. Here, the Digital Twin Studio’s features based on the guest’s personalization of the ride were activated. Guests were able to interact with their personalized 3D avatar and experience Magneti Marelli’s award-winning A-pillar to A-pillar “black mirror” displays, ambient lighting, smart surfaces, driver monitoring and human machine interface technologies. Ultra-narrow modules and light guide technology were also integrated into the front of the vehicle.

Magneti Marelli will also showcase its lighting and display technologies in the field of "Affordable Design". These solutions feature simplified hardware and software designs - fewer parts, lighter weight, lower CO2 emissions and lower costs than traditional lighting and display products. These designs are achieved through technology optimization, design-for-manufacturing methods and supply chain localization.

Technologies related to vehicle performance will be on display in the Performance Design Area, including Magneti Marelli’s fully active electromechanical suspension system, domain control unit, integrated thermal management module and wireless battery management system driven by artificial intelligence (AI).

The future of mobility will be unveiled in the “Layout for the Future” area, which will give us a glimpse into the next phase of Magneti Marelli’s design – an in-car experience driven by artificial intelligence – including advanced audio and sound zoning, electrically hidden displays and interior components, console projection, eco-friendly materials, multi-modal interaction, HD headlights with floor projection, multi-color illuminated front fascia and grille, exterior information display, rear window projection and more.

About Magneti Marelli

Magneti Marelli is a leading global automotive supplier, renowned for its innovation and manufacturing excellence. Working with customers and partners, it is committed to creating a safer, greener and more connected future of mobility. Magneti Marelli has established 170 factories and R&D centers around the world, with approximately 50,000 employees, in Asia, America, Europe and Africa.
